Let IT Go: Outsource IT to See Your Business Growing Smoothly

NRCC, PRAS Consulting and Telekom Romania have the pleasure to invite you to attend an interactive IT&C Knowledge Center, organized on 18th of January, from 6:30 pm, at Athénée Palace Hilton hotel, in Bucharest.
The presentations are followed by a Cocktail Drink. Free access for NRCC members; 120 lei for non-members. Register at info@nrcc.ro, until 17th of January.

Adrian Popa is managing Telekom Romania’s Hosting Data Center and Cloud Infrastructure service portfolio since 2011. In 2013 they launched Telekom’s Virtual Data Center (VDC) services which became market leader in the local IaaS market. VDC is a virtual private cloud service that provides enterprise grade IT infrastructure (computing, storage, connectivity and more) in a resilient, scalable and secure manner to the local business.
Prior to 2011, he managed the web hosting product portfolio of Telekom, ensuring double digit revenue growth of the Telekom BeOnline and Reseller Hosting brands for four years in a row. Telekom Romania is a dynamic brand, offering mobile and fixed innovative communication services to a broad customer community, using approximately 10 million services. In 2015, Telekom Romania launched the commercial concept MagentaONE and offered simplified integrated fixed and mobile bundles to both residential and business customers. MagentaONE stands for one Call Center, one bill, one MyAccount application (including one mobile app). Through MagentaONE, Telekom Romania reinforced its leadership position in providing complete telecommunications and IT&C solutions to Romanian companies.
